WebAug 17, 2024 · According to the Medicaid and CHIP Payment and Access Commission (MACPAC), FFS inpatient hospital base payments in Medicaid were 22 percent below comparable Medicare rates. To narrow or close this gap, many states make supplemental payments to some or all hospitals in their state.
